.Plastic container-manufacturing company Tupperware has formally applied for bankruptcy, with its head of state and also chief executive officer Laurie Ann Goldman mentioning financial struggles caused due to the "daunting macroeconomic atmosphere" in a claim..
The 78-year-old company, established through innovator Earl Tupper, who developed the initial Tupperware items in 1946, has observed ups as well as downs throughout its own life-- mainly ups between the 1950s and also 1960s when "Tupperware events" were actually a factor. Its direct purchases organization model created it a somebody, and so it stuck to it for greater than 7 many years and simply started selling products in retail setups in 2022..
Simply a year after Tupperware's strong relocate to begin selling its own plastic food storing compartments in Aim at retail stores, nonetheless, Tupperware disclosed in a regulative submission that it had actually found help from monetary consultants as it was actually already straining to stay afloat financially..
On Tuesday, Tupperware officially declared bankruptcy. Yet in spite of the damaging connotation of the condition, filing for this legal procedure does certainly not automatically imply the end of the road for a business. As an alternative, it provides new opportunities that can lead insolvent firms to develop down the road..
Recognizing personal bankruptcy in a service situation.
Necessarily, insolvency is actually a legal procedure companies take when they can no longer understand their financial commitments. There are distinct types of insolvency filings, yet all of all of them are designed to guard services from financial institutions as they identify as well as reorganize their funds. In the corporate globe, Chapter 7 and also Chapter 11 personal bankruptcies are one of the most generally used through having a hard time providers..
Section 7 personal bankruptcy is actually when a company determines to end all procedures and also sell off properties to repay debts in preparation for the closing of your business. Alternatively, Section 11 bankruptcy provides organizations the amount of time to reorganize their personal debts without ceasing procedures. When business declare Phase 11, they are actually storing out chance they are going to go back to ordinary service procedures later on.

In Tupperware's claim, the Orlando, Florida-based firm declared Phase 11 personal bankruptcy protection, claiming it would certainly proceed spending its own workers as well as vendors surrounded by the process..
" We organize to carry on providing our valued consumers with the high-quality products they adore as well as rely on throughout this method," Goldman claimed in the declaration. She added that the personal bankruptcy filing "is implied to provide our company with crucial flexibility as our company pursue key options to sustain our improvement into a digital-first, technology-led company.".
Breaking the judgment surrounding personal bankruptcy.
While lots of check out the concept of declare bankruptcy as a last resort, a number of prosperous corporations and also services have in fact turned to this calculated move in the skin of economic situation. Rotating in the course of difficult times needs economizing as well as tactical. Declare bankruptcy-- specifically the Chapter 11 style-- gives companies leeway to far better manage their financial problems and emerge stronger..
American Airlines, Delta, General Motors as well as Wonder are only some of the firms that took advantage of personal bankruptcy filings. After decreasing debts, renegotiating effort contracts and refocusing on even more successful jobs, these labels had the ability to leave personal bankruptcy, recover as well as flourish..
The concept of corporate insolvency being a score of an organization's impending death has actually dramatically transformed via the years, after observing the number of organizations have had the capacity to bounce back during the personal bankruptcy time period. Today, even more business owners, clients and also creditors take into consideration insolvency as either a reboot switch or even a sign that a provider agrees to take risks and also execute a lasting method for healing.
